Liverpool recorded a statement 4-0 win against Bayer Leverkusen to ruin Xabi Alonso’s return to Anfield as they made it four wins from four UEFA Champions League games under Arne Slot.
Luis Diaz was the star of the show as his second-half hat trick coupled with a Cody Gakpo header set the Reds on their way to a commanding win.
It was a memorable night for the Colombian, who scored his first Treble since joining Liverpool in January 2022.
After the game, Diaz’s popular chant was played on the PA system to celebrate one of his best outings for Liverpool.

Diaz’s stats vs Leverkusen
Slot lauded Diaz for his performance against Brighton last week and the attacker repaid his manager’s faith in him with a fantastic treble against one of the most exciting teams in Europe.
His underlying numbers from the game are as follows:
- One key pass
- Three shots on target
- Three goals
- 1.64 xG
- 35 touches with an 88% pass accuracy (22/25 passes completed)
